The levels in neutron-rich odd-A ^(107,109)Ru nuclei have been investigated by using γ -γ -and γ -γ -γ-coincidence studies of the prompt γ-rays from the spontaneous fission of 252Cf. The ground state bands and the negative parity bands are identified and expanded in both nuclei. Triaxial rotor plus particle model calculations indicate the ground state bands originate from v(d_(5/2)+g_(7/2)) quasiparticle configurations and the negative parity bands are from vh_(11/2) orbital. 展开更多

Level schemes for the neutron-rich ^(140,143)Ba nuclei have been determined by study of promptγ-rays in spontaneous fission of ^(252)Cf.The level pattern and enhanced E1 transitions betweenπ=+andπ=-bands show reflection asymmetric shapes with simplex quantum number s=+1 in ^(140)Ba and s=±i in ^(143)Ba,respectively.The octupole deformation stability with spin variation has been discussed. 展开更多

用在束γ谱实验技术,对^(68)Ge、^(65)Ga与^(67)Ga的高自族态进行了研究。所用核反应为^(46)Ti(^(25)Mg,xpxn),束流能量为68MeV。在^(68)Ge中,观测到新的8^+以上的多带结构、带间的交叉跃迁及一个新的可能具有大形变的带。新的微观模型(... 用在束γ谱实验技术,对^(68)Ge、^(65)Ga与^(67)Ga的高自族态进行了研究。所用核反应为^(46)Ti(^(25)Mg,xpxn),束流能量为68MeV。在^(68)Ge中,观测到新的8^+以上的多带结构、带间的交叉跃迁及一个新的可能具有大形变的带。新的微观模型(EXCITED FED VAMPIR)的计算结果与实验数据比较得到满意的符合。在^(65)Ga与^(67)Ga中,给出了这两种核的新的能级图,观测到集体性很强的带结构。 展开更多
